Description : The post holder will be responsible for the day to day management of the administrative staff within Health Records to ensure maximum productivity and efficiency in administrative working practices and the provision of a high quality service.
Other key responsibilities include supporting the Trust Wide Operational Health Records Manager with all relevant operational, Human Resource, and other Trust/local policies/procedures to ensure the day-to-day management of departmental performance. The post holder will provide cover for the Trust Wide Operational Health Records Manager.
Through the management of one of the Health Records Departmets, the post-holder will be required to: Operate under their own initiative and take responsibility for daily decision making
Have an innovative approach to problem solving and developing services
Ensure effective and efficient delivery of the service to meet service demands
The post-holder will also attend meetings as required, and work flexibly to meet departmental and service needs.
An exciting secondment opportunity has arisen for a full-time Band 5 Assistant Health Records & Scanning Bureau Manager to provide a comprehensive, efficient and effective service for the Trust Medical Records & Electronic Document Management service managed within Digital Services.
Applicants will need to be proactive and have exceptional organisation skills. The successful candidate will need to be able to communicate with both their team and all levels of staff internally and externally in a professional manner.
Applicants must have a keen eye for detail and possess a level of scanning expertise, as the job will involve the management of an extremely busy scanning bureau.
University Hospitals Bristol & Weston NHS Foundation Trust (UHBW) is one of the largest acute Trusts in the country, with a workforce of over 13,000 staff and 100+ different clinical services across 10 sites, serving a population of over 500,000 people across Bristol and Weston. UHBW has been rated by the CQC as ‘Good’ overall and our staff are proud to deliver excellent care to patients. As a forward-thinking multi-award winning Trust, committed to improving patient care, our world-leading research and innovations are having a positive local and global impact.
